When searching for the best male swimwear brands, several factors come into play:
- Material Quality: Look for quick-drying, durable, and chlorine-resistant fabrics like polyester, nylon, or recycled materials.
- Fit and Comfort: Swimwear should offer a comfortable fit that flatters your body shape without restricting movement.
- Style and Design: From classic cuts to bold patterns, your swimwear should reflect your personality and suit your intended use.
- Functionality: Features like adjustable waistbands, pockets, mesh linings, and UV protection enhance usability.
- Sustainability: Eco-conscious brands use recycled or organic materials, appealing to environmentally aware consumers.

To keep your swimwear in top condition:
- Rinse it in cold water immediately after use to remove chlorine or salt.
- Hand wash gently with mild detergent.
- Avoid wringing; instead, press out excess water.
- Air dry in the shade to prevent fading and fabric damage.

Men's swimwear comes in various styles, each suited for different activities and preferences. Understanding these styles can help you choose the best swimwear brand that offers what you need.
- Swim Briefs: Also known as "speedos," these are tight-fitting and provide minimal coverage, ideal for competitive swimming and those who prefer less fabric.
- Swim Trunks: The most common style, usually mid-length and loose-fitting, perfect for casual beach days and pool parties.
- Board Shorts: Longer than swim trunks, often reaching the knees, designed for surfing and water sports.
- Jammers: Knee-length, tight-fitting shorts favored by competitive swimmers for reduced drag.
- Square Leg Swimsuits: A hybrid between briefs and jammers, offering moderate coverage and a snug fit.
Modern swimwear brands incorporate advanced technology to enhance performance and comfort. Some key technologies include:
- Water-Repellent Coatings: Help swimwear dry faster and resist water absorption.
- Chlorine-Resistant Fabrics: Extend the life of swimwear by preventing damage from pool chemicals.
- UV Protection: Fabrics that block harmful UV rays to protect your skin.
- Seamless Designs: Reduce chafing and improve comfort during extended wear.
Buying swimwear online can be convenient but challenging. Here are some tips to ensure a good purchase:
- Check the brand's sizing chart carefully and measure yourself accurately.
- Read customer reviews for insights on fit and quality.
- Look for return policies that allow exchanges or refunds.
- Consider ordering multiple sizes if unsure and return what doesn't fit.
- Pay attention to fabric descriptions and care instructions.
